If by "64-bit version" you mean "Leopard," then yes.
There are no separate versions. Leopard has 64-bit libraries and 32-bit libraries for programs to link against. If your chip is 64-bit capable, then it'll use those. If not, it'll use the 32-bit ones. Simple! Which is, of course, a synonym for Apple.